The story of the Still family went viral in the summer of 2014 after Devon was cut from the Cincinnati Bengals team after a lackluster training camp.
Team officials learned he’d been having trouble focusing on football after finding out his daughter Leah was battling cancer.
The Bengals signed the defense lineman to their practice squad so all of Leah’s treatment would be covered by the team.
Leah and Devon became a national sensation, sparking a movement to help “sack pediatric cancer.”
